Brand Sales Analyst needs 2 years of experience in a similar role involving sales analysis

Brand Sales Analyst requires:

 Bachelor’s Degree

 2 years of experience in a similar role involving sales analysis

 Demonstrated experience working with multiple data sources including Retail POS from syndicated source (SPS or Edifice)

 Must have strong knowledge of retail sell out and retail math.

 Strong analytical skills, verbal and written skills, as well as strong presentation skills

 Ability to develop and maintain key management relationships within the department store environment

 Effective project management skills and strong organization/time mgt.

 Demonstrated ability to succeed in a complex environment

 Strong PC skills, including Excel, SAP, Pivot Tables, V-look Up

Brand Sales Analyst duties:

 Supports the sales team in the achievement of annual performance objectives including sales units, dollars and AUP.

 Delivers data analysis to senior management (US and global), product, marketing, and demand planning teams weekly, monthly, seasonally by product category and channel.

 Reporting responsibilities include but are not limited to: retail sell through, wholesale shipments, account inventory levels, sell-in, sell-thru, performance tracking, stock to sales ratio, top door analysis, ROI

 Contributes to development of seasonal recaps that identify successes and opportunities to influence sales strategies and drive future brand and assortment planning.

 Provides a consistent rolling update to internal teams of business outlook as compared to forecast and budget on a monthly basis.

 Active collaboration with Sales in defining assortment strategies by account consistent updates to the Assortment Management Tool

 Partner with the Account Managers to plan new market introductions.
